The Adaptive Strategic Execution Program (ASEP), built in partnership between Duke Corporate Education and Korn Ferry, focuses explicitly on building leaders who can master the three domains that influence and define how work gets done: strategy, work and people.
The curriculum consists of eight courses, each aligning to two or more of these domains and addressing an emerging leadership challenge.
Certificate information
- Course Certificate: For each ASEP course you complete, earn a course certificate of completion from Duke Corporate Education.
- Program Certificate: Take the two required courses and four electives, totaling six courses, to complete the program and earn a program certificate of completion from Duke University’s Fuqua School of Business.
- Certified SEP Letter of Distinction: Upon completion of the program, you can choose to apply for a distinction and become a certified Strategic Execution Professional (SEP) by submitting a written assignment to the ASEP Academic Council. Receive a letter of distinction from Duke Corporate Education and add credentials to your title.
